Official license checks and verification
Official license checks and verification are essential steps in due diligence because license numbers can be misrepresented or outdated. A legitimate operator will publish current regulator references that you can validate directly with the regulator’s official databases. If you cannot locate a regulator entry or the license details do not align with the operator’s stated information, treat the claim with caution and seek confirmation from the regulator or an independent industry source.
Verify license numbers by visiting the regulator’s public registry and searching for the operator’s name, license type, and code. Confirm the license status is active, the scope matches the site’s advertised services (for example, whether the license covers online casino games, live dealer, or sports betting), and the expiry date is current. If any regulator has delayed or suspended activity related to the operator, this is a strong warning sign that warrants further scrutiny.
In practice, you should also look for corroborating regulator records such as disclosures of ownership, corporate structure, and any conditions or restrictions placed on the license. When multiple regulators are listed, ensure each license is individually valid and that the operator is compliant with the specific regulatory obligations tied to that jurisdiction. If discrepancies arise between regulator databases or if a license appears in a warning or enforcement notice, pause due diligence and contact the regulator directly for clarification.
Maintaining a clear paper trail—license numbers, regulator names, expiry dates, and the scope of each license—facilitates ongoing monitoring. Regularly revisit regulator announcements and registry updates, as license statuses can change due to audits, changes in ownership, or new regulatory guidance. If all checks align, these license signals strengthen the operator’s legitimacy profile, though they should be interpreted alongside other security and user experience indicators.
Security technology: encryption, data protection, and audits
Security technology is a cornerstone of trust for online casinos. The site should employ strong encryption for data in transit, typically TLS with up-to-date protocols (TLS 1.2 or 1.3) and 256-bit encryption for sensitive data such as payment details. You should see the site served over HTTPS with a valid certificate, and you can inspect the certificate to verify the issuer and validity period. Encryption protects information as it moves between your device and the operator’s servers, reducing the risk of interception or tampering.
Data protection and privacy controls are equally important. Operators should publish a comprehensive privacy policy that explains what data is collected, how long it is retained, how it is used, and what rights players have to access or delete their information. Compliance with applicable data protection regulations (for example, GDPR in the EU) signals a commitment to responsible data handling, access controls, and breach notification protocols. Look for explicit statements about data minimization, role-based access, and regular security training for staff.
Independent audits and testing form the third pillar of security, covering both technical defenses and game fairness. Reputable operators engage third-party firms to assess vulnerabilities, verify RNG fairness, and test payment security controls. Commonly cited auditors include independent testing labs and fairness certifiers such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These audits help confirm that the random number generator operates correctly and that games are not skewed in favor of the house. For payments, independent reviews of transaction processing, fraud detection, and chargeback handling provide extra assurance that financial interactions are secure and properly managed.
Finally, payment security and fraud prevention are critical. The operator should support secure payment processors, tokenization, PCI-DSS compliance for card transactions, and options for two-factor authentication or strong customer authentication where available. Ongoing fraud monitoring and clear procedures for dispute resolution further strengthen security signals for users and ensure a safer gaming environment over time.

Withdrawal policies, verification process, and common issues
Withdrawal policies at Mr Vegas Casino include a verification-driven process, standard anti-money-laundering safeguards, and rules about limits and eligible payment methods. Before payouts, most players must complete KYC verification, which commonly includes providing a government-issued ID, a proof of address, and sometimes a payment method statement. The time to verify documents can range from a few hours to a couple of business days, depending on the volume of requests and the clarity of the documents. Once verification is complete, withdrawals are typically reviewed for compliance with bonus terms and wagering requirements if funds are tied to bonuses. Common hold reasons include ongoing bonus wagering, suspected fraud, or unresolved identity checks. If a withdrawal is temporarily blocked, players should check the account status for any outstanding verification requests or documents that need updating. We discuss the standard processing flow: request withdrawal, audit by compliance, and transfer to the chosen method. Delays can occur if there are discrepancies in the user’s information or if funds originate from a bonus balance rather than real money. We explain how to resolve issues quickly: submit missing documents, contact support with the transaction ID, and verify that the requested method is supported for withdrawal. Some players experience longer waits for high-value withdrawals or cross-border transfers, and banks may impose additional verification for large sums. We also cover common issues such as declined payments due to regional restrictions, chargebacks, or revocation of funds for bonus non-compliance. Providing clear documentation and staying within the casino’s stated limits helps avoid surprises. Finally, we summarize best practices for a smooth payout: ensure identity documents are current, understand the withdrawal method’s processing times, and confirm that any promotional funds have been cleared before requesting a big withdrawal.
